Offered Online
Dubai, United Arab Emirates
Las Vegas, United States
London, United Kingdom
Wellington, New Zealand
Toronto, Canada
Scotland
Washington DC, United States
Berlin, Germany
Singapore
Enter your email and subscribe for regular updates from Innoverto